There are typically 3 principal stages in the perception of pain. The main phase is pain sensitivity, accompanied by the 2nd stage where by the signals are transmitted from your periphery to your dorsal horn (DH), which is found within the spinal wire by way of the peripheral nervous procedure (PNS). And lastly, the third stage will be to perform the transmission from the signals to the higher Mind through the central nervous process (CNS). Generally, There's two routes for signal transmissions for being carried out: ascending and descending pathways. The pathway that goes upward carrying sensory data from the body by way of the spinal twine in direction of the Mind is described because the ascending pathway, While the nerves that goes downward with the Mind into the reflex organs by way of the spinal wire is called the descending pathway.
